Institute of Political Leadership Announces Launch of 'Politicians Club' in New Delhi

The Institute of Political Leadership (IPL) has announced the launch of ‘Politicians Club’, an exclusive platform envisioned for political leaders, policymakers and aspiring politicians, with a focus on political training, leadership development, meaningful dialogue and high-level networking.
 

Strategically located in Connaught Place, New Delhi, the Politicians Club is being developed as a dedicated hub for political excellence, leadership development and political networking. The facility will span approximately 10,000 sq. ft. within a state-of-the-art building of more than 20,000 sq. ft.

The proposed club will feature an Auditorium and Model Parliament for structured debates, policy discussions and parliamentary simulations. It will also include Advanced Training Halls for live and online political training programmes, along with a dedicated Podcast and Media Zone equipped for podcasts, live streaming and professional audio-video production.

The Institute said political training programmes are currently being conducted across India, and the new club will provide a dedicated space for year-round political learning, interaction, discussions and media engagement.
 

Under its lifetime membership programme, members will have access to political training programmes, seminars and events, along with opportunities to participate in in-house debates, speeches and political discussions. Members will also have access to podcast and media facilities, social media support services, political networking opportunities and VIP political events.
 

The programme also aims to provide members with personalised political roadmaps and long-term mentoring, business training opportunities for members and their families, regular political updates through the Institute’s app, and opportunities to participate in political delegations and study tours in India and abroad.
 

Another key initiative is Next Generation Leadership Planning, aimed at helping political families develop long-term leadership capabilities and sustain their political legacy. Members may also have their profiles featured on the Institute’s app to facilitate networking and team-building opportunities in their respective areas.
 

Lifetime Honorary Membership

The Institute of Political Leadership has also announced a Lifetime Honorary Membership for distinguished constitutional and political office holders, offered without charge. The initiative includes the President of India, Vice President of India, Leaders of Opposition in the Lok Sabha and Rajya Sabha, and Chief Ministers of States and Union Territories, subject to their acceptance.
 

The initiative is intended to create a platform where experienced political leaders can share their journeys, challenges, struggles and lessons from public life with aspiring leaders and the wider public.

Membership and Eligibility

Members enrolled in the Institute’s five-year MP/MLA-level VIP Political Training and Consultancy Programme will be eligible for lifetime membership. Eligible individuals may also apply directly for membership.
 

The Institute said the membership programme is designed to create a long-term ecosystem for political education, leadership development, networking and mentorship.
